Delegation (or delegating) is the process of distributing and entrusting work to another person.  

To me, the process of delegating is a powerful offshoot and manifestation of networking. Thus, if one has a potent network, as we do in 
www.gothamnetwoking.com, we are in a position to accomplish the task at hand in the quickest and most effective manner with the help of our members (you know who you are).

We are fortunate to have each other, with our varied skill sets, talents, experience and willingness to help.
